Where will I work ??

 As an electronic professional opportunities are:

  • To work with semiconductor companies like Intel,Toshiba,Samsung,AMD etc
  • As an electronic engineer on will work in fields of VLSI which is divided in frontend & Backend
  • One can Work in frontend includes coding and testing of design on tools as a design or verification engineer.
  • Can also work as backend professional who deals with timing related issues in a design.
  • One can work with EDA comapnies like Cadence, Magma,Synopsis etc. These develop tools to cater to semiconductor industries to carry their design process.

How do I pursue this career ??

» To get an entry-level engineering job, one usually needs a bachelor's degree in engineering. . The career chronology to be a eectronics engineer is :

» The minimum eligibility required to get admission in Bachelors in civil engineering  is 10+2 with good marks.  

» The course requirements in 10+2 are Physics, Chemistry and Math.                       

»    The 10+2 mark cutoffs for admissions are different for different institutes. Ex: BITS-Pilani ( min 80%) IIT ( 60%)

»  Opportunities lies in going further for higher studies for Masters and Ph.D

»  At the Masters level, one can opt for specialized subjects like VLSI, Digital Electronics etc.

 

»  To take admissions in premier national institutes competitive exams are held every year BITSAT, IIT-JEE , AIEEE

 

 

»  State wide entrance exams are also held to take admission in regional engineering colleges.
